San Francisco Contemporary Music Players present:
Concert #3
part of LOU HARRISON: A CENTENARY CELEBRATION, A Weekend Festival
Saturday, April 22, 2017 at 7:30PM

Z Space
450 Florida Street
San Francisco, CA 94110


Program:

Lou Harrison, Suite for Cello and Harp (1949) (12')
Cello, Harp

Gity Razaz, Shadow Lines (2014) (10')
Cello and Electronics

Lou Harrison, Scenes from Nek Chand (2001/2) (11')
Steel Guitar [National] Mr. Harrison’s last piece, dedicated to SFCMP guitarist, David Tanenbaum and Carol Law and Charles Amirkhanian

Composer conversation with Natacha Diels

Natacha Diels, The Colors Don’t Match (2014) (11')
*west coast premiere Piccolo, violin, clarinet, voice, glockenspiel, vibraphone, electronics
